Izabela Domagała-Mańczyk1, Marta Miszczuk-Cieśla1, Marta Maskey-Warzęchowska1
1Department of Internal Medicine, Pulmonary Diseases and Allergy, Medical University of Warsaw, Banacha 1A, 02-097 Warsaw, Poland.
Most adults with asthma or COPD misuse inhalers, especially Metered Dose Inhalers (MDIs). Proper inhalation technique (IT) education is crucial but often insufficient, leading to frequent errors in managing these airway obstructive diseases.
Area of Science:
- Respiratory Medicine
- Clinical Pharmacy
- Patient Education
Background:
- Correct inhalation technique (IT) is vital for managing airway obstructive diseases like asthma and COPD.
- Inhaler misuse is prevalent among patients, compromising treatment efficacy.
- Assessing IT and identifying factors contributing to errors is essential for improving patient outcomes.
Purpose of the Study:
- To evaluate the inhalation technique (IT) in adults with asthma and COPD.
- To identify demographic and clinical factors associated with correct and incorrect inhaler use.
- To determine the impact of prior training on IT among these patient groups.
Main Methods:
- A single-center case-control study involving 180 adult patients with asthma or COPD.
- IT assessed using a checklist, a four-grade scale, and peak inspiratory flow.
- Comparison of patients with correct vs. incorrect IT across various factors including demographics, disease characteristics, cognitive function, and prior training.
Main Results:
- Only 37.8% of patients used their inhalers properly; Metered Dose Inhaler (MDI) users had lower correct IT rates than Dry Powder Inhaler (DPI) users (p < 0.001).
- Correct IT was not associated with age, gender, education, motivation, or cognitive/sensory impairments.
- Among MDI users, correct IT correlated with reading drug leaflets (p = 0.015); among DPI users, it correlated with better self-assessment (p = 0.046) and prior training (p = 0.001).
Conclusions:
- A significant majority of adults with asthma and COPD exhibit improper inhaler technique, with MDI users being particularly affected.
- Inadequate patient education regarding proper IT remains a critical and unresolved issue.
- Targeted educational interventions focusing on IT are necessary to improve inhaler use and disease management.
